תוכן עניינים:

שעון ספירה לאחור עם נוריות LED: 3 שלבים
שעון ספירה לאחור עם נוריות LED: 3 שלבים

וִידֵאוֹ: שעון ספירה לאחור עם נוריות LED: 3 שלבים

וִידֵאוֹ: שעון ספירה לאחור עם נוריות LED: 3 שלבים
וִידֵאוֹ: שעון,ספירה לאחור,טיימר,סטופר לד למשחקים, תוכנת מיוחדות,לד סטאר, 0507721333 2024, נוֹבֶמבֶּר
Anonim
שעון ספירה לאחור עם נוריות
שעון ספירה לאחור עם נוריות

אלה כמה הערות קצרות על 'שעון ספירה לאחור' שבניתי לפני 10 שנים עבור Y2K, השעון הוא 4 רגל מרובע מהחזית. עוביו כ- 4 סנטימטרים, ופועל על מיקרו -בקר מוטבע. כל קטע בנוי מסביבות LED בגודל 20x10 מ מ בערך.

אני לא יכול לצלם עם זה, כי זה WAAAY בהיר מדי! הלוח נחצב מתבנית שהכנתי לנתב רגיל, עם תבנית מורחבת בעקבות חותך. הכנתי את התבנית בלוח קשיח (סיבי לוח US-ian?) ופשוט יישרתי אותה בזהירות עם סימנים בלוח כדי לחתוך אותה. פריסת ה- Leds השנייה הייתה יותר זונה ממה שציפיתי - בצע את החישוב בזהירות כדי להעלות אותם בצורה מושלמת.

שלב 1: ספרה

ספרה
ספרה
ספרה
ספרה

להלן מבט על החלק האחורי של קטע. השתמשתי במעגל הזרם הקבוע LM317 הקלאסי כדי להניע כל בנק נוריות.

מנהלי ההתקנים של התצוגות נעשים עם ממירים סדרתיים-מקבילים שנראה כי הוחלפו בדברים הבאים: לעשות את כל מה שעשיתי אז גם עם 317 - נהג LED שלם בשבב אחד. רק נגד אחד קובע את הבהירות לכל הלדים! כל ספרה מונעת על ידי אותו כבל סרט כבול, הנושא את כל האותות הנפוצים לשבבים אלה, Vcc, שעון GND, הפעלת תפס ופלט. אז רק 6 חוטים עוזבים את המחשב עבור כל הקטעים של כל הדמויות וגם נוריות ה- 60 השניות סביב הקצה. בכל שבב כונן יש קו ייחודי אחד (החוט הוורוד) שמחברת חיננית בכל המערכת. התצוגה נראית כמו רישום משמרות ארוך מאוד - ראה תרשים להלן עדכון לתצוגה לוקח שבריר זעיר מאוד של שנייה.

שלב 2: המיקרו -בקר

המיקרו -בקר
המיקרו -בקר

אני בהחלט אוהב את המיקרו -בקר 8052, השני שלו שמקורו ושופץ כמעט על ידי כולם. משתמש מקצועי, יכול אפילו להוריד קוד VHDL כדי ליישם קוד אחד ב- FPGA, ולשפר את כל הליבה כדי להניע חומרה מוזרה שאכפת לי להעלות. היצרנים כוללים את Atmel, NXP ו- WinBond. כלי הפיתוח זולים עד מאוד, יש גם מכלולים בחינם וגם מהדרי 'C' בחינם (SDCC). למעשה תכננתי את זה לגמרי בפסקאל עם פיסת קוד מכלול שנכתב במיוחד כדי לבצע את עדכון התצוגה כמה שיותר מהר. מתישהו אפרסם גם את הקוד. זהו מחשב השליטה. המעבד נקרא Dallas DS2250T, והוא הגיע כלוח קטן בסגנון כרטיס SIMM המכיל 32K זיכרון RAM מגובה סוללה, המשמש לתוכניות ו- 8K RAM לשימוש בנתוני תוכניות. שבבי 40 הפינים הגדולים יותר הם שבבים סדרתיים עד מקבילים עבור הלדים השניים. מתחת לחבילות 40 הפינים יש שבב של נהג קו LS125, להנעת כבלי הסרט. המחבר הלבן בחלקו העליון היה עבור מערכת כפתורי לחיצה להגדרת השעון.

שלב 3: הערות תוכנה

הערות תוכנה
הערות תוכנה

כתבתי פיסת קוד מחשב פשוטה כדי להבין כמה שעות בדיוק יש בכל מרווח בין שרצית שהספירה לאחור תתחיל לבין "שעה אפס", התוכנית המשובצת פשוט בדקה את השעון הפנימי שלה כל שנייה והורידה את התצוגה. בכל דקה, כל האורות נדלקו, וכיבו בהדרגה עד שהגעת שוב ל -60. יש לוח לחצן קטן להגדרת התצוגה, בדיוק כמו שעון מעורר.

מוּמלָץ: